Rutger published: Public Outcry at Town Halls: Citizens Challenge GOP Officials Across the Nation

Across the United States, citizens are fervently attending town hall meetings hosted by Republican lawmakers during the congressional recess. The atmosphere at these gatherings is charged with palpable discontent and vocal criticism directed at decisions and policies emanating from the GOP and the White House.

Frustration and Dissent in Georgia

At a recent event in Georgia, Rep. Richard McCormick faced intense scrutiny from his constituents. The discontent stemmed from his defense of Elon Musk’s controversial budget cuts to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C). Based in Atlanta, the CDC plays a crucial role in safeguarding public health, and the reductions have sparked widespread concern. When McCormick was pressed about his actions to address what was described as the "megalomania" of the current administration, the room erupted in applause.

McCormick’s comparison of these concerned citizens to the January 6 rioters only fanned the flames of frustration, drawing sharp rebukes from those present who emphasized their peaceful yet passionate demand for accountability.

California’s Cry for Justice: "No Kings!"

In California, Rep. Jay Obernolte found himself at the center of a protest where attendees chanted, "No kings! No kings!" This was a pointed reference to recent declarations from the White House likening the president to a monarch, following an executive order aimed at consolidating power over independent agencies.

The sentiment at this event was clear: constituents were unwilling to accept any erosion of democratic principles and were adamant about preserving the checks and balances integral to the nation's governance.

Oregon’s Call for Economic Accountability

Meanwhile, in Oregon, Rep. Cliff Bentz was confronted by constituents accusing him of complacency in the face of what they described as a dismantling of governmental structures by powerful figures like Trump and Musk. Chants of "Tax Elon!" resounded through the gathering, underscoring the demand for fair taxation and corporate accountability.

Oklahoma's Stand on Veterans' Rights

In Oklahoma, Rep. Stephanie Bice encountered a particularly impassioned encounter with a retired Army officer. The officer’s criticism centered on the perception that young tech prodigies employed by Musk were undermining essential government programs. Bice’s retort, which involved unfounded claims about veterans’ benefits being diverted to undocumented immigrants, was met with skepticism and rejection from the crowd.

The officer called out the response as a diversionary tactic, emphasizing that veterans' rights must not be compromised under any circumstances.

Wisconsin’s Rejection of Unilateral Decisions

Rep. Scott Fitzgerald’s listening session in Wisconsin became a battleground of ideas, as attendees voiced their opposition to proposed cuts in support for Ukraine and Trump’s self-declaration as "king." One constituent passionately declared the urgency of addressing "illegal actions" that are already impacting citizens, while Fitzgerald’s promise of future oversight was met with jeers.

Similarly, Rep. Glenn Grothman was met with boos as he defended measures that would terminate birthright citizenship and diversity, equity, and inclusion initiatives. The public’s response was a clear indictment of policies perceived as regressive and unjust.
